Understanding the Current Landscape

First and foremost, it’s essential to grasp the current state of river flow data analysis. Today, the field is characterized by an increasing reliance on advanced sensor technologies and big data analytics. For instance, the integration of IoT (Internet of Things) devices across river systems allows for real-time monitoring of water levels, temperature, and flow rates. This real-time data is crucial for understanding and predicting changes in river dynamics, which is vital for managing water resources, preventing floods, and ensuring ecological health.

Moreover, the use of machine learning algorithms is becoming increasingly prevalent. These algorithms can process vast amounts of data to identify patterns and make forecasts that are more accurate than traditional models. For example, machine learning can predict flood risks with greater precision, helping communities prepare and mitigate damages. Innovations in Data Visualization

Data visualization plays a crucial role in making complex hydrological data accessible and understandable. The latest trends in this area include the use of interactive dashboards and geospatial mapping tools. These tools not only present data in an engaging and user-friendly manner but also enable users to interact with the data, making it easier to draw meaningful insights. For instance, interactive dashboards can allow stakeholders to explore different scenarios and their potential impacts on river systems.

Another innovative trend is the use of virtual and augmented reality (VR/AR) for visualizing river flow data. These technologies can create immersive experiences that help educate the public and policymakers about the importance of river conservation and management. This not only raises awareness but also fosters a deeper understanding of the complexities involved in managing river systems.

Future Developments in River Flow Data Analysis and Visualization

Looking ahead, the future of river flow data analysis and visualization is promising. One key trend is the development of more sophisticated art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) models. These models are expected to become even more accurate and reliable, providing more precise predictions and insights. For example, AI could be used to predict changes in river flow due to climate change, helping water management agencies plan and adapt their strategies accordingly.

Additionally, there is a growing emphasis on the integration of data from multiple sources, including satellite imagery, weather data, and historical records. This holistic approach ensures that all relevant information is considered when analyzing river systems, leading to more robust and comprehensive insights.
